Title: Innovator Klaus Risbjerg Jarlkov: Pioneering Catalytic Reactor Technologies

Introduction

Klaus Risbjerg Jarlkov, an accomplished inventor based in Hårlev, Denmark, has made significant contributions to the field of catalytic reactors, holding a remarkable total of 14 patents. His innovative designs aim to en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of catalytic processes in industrial applications.

Latest Patents

Among Klaus Jarlkov's latest patents are two groundbreaking technologies that showcase his expertise in catalytic reactor design. The first is a "Catalytic reactor with floating particle catcher," which includes a unique floating particle catcher unit. This design effectively extracts particles from the fluid flow above the catalyst bed, preventing clogging and ensuring optimal functionality.

The second patent, titled "Catalytic reactor with load distributor assembly," introduces a load distributor assembly that facilitates even load distribution from the reactor internals to the support ring. This innovation maximizes the potential load application without requiring any modifications or exceeding allowed tensions, demonstrating Klaus's commitment to advancing reactor technology.
